THE EXECUTIVE.

ANDREW JOHNSON, of Tennessee, President of the United States.
LAFAYETTE S. FOSTER, of Connecticut, President pro tempore of the Senate,

and Acting Vice President..

THE CABINET.

WILLIAM H. SEWARD, of New York, Secretary of State..
HUGH MCCULLOCH, of Indiana, Secretary of the Treasury.
EDWIN M. STANTON, of Pennsylvania, Secretary of War..
GIDEON WELLES, of Connecticut, Secretary of the Navy..
JAMES HARLAN, of Iowa, Secretary of the Interior
JAMES SPEED, of Kentucky, Attorney-General...
WILLIAM DENNISON, of Ohio, Postmaster-General
